Before You Begin

If you are a new user of the cordless digital telephone, find out if your Strata DK system has Tone or Voice First Signaling. The difference is Tone Signaling rings while Voice First Signaling notifies you with a long tone, and then the caller’s voice. Both signals are enabled in system programming and determine how you make and answer calls on your cordless digital telephone.

You can toggle between Tone and Voice First Signaling on a call-by-call basis.
